"Multiple Chanakyas are advising the prince. The trouble is, there is only one prince. A problem that Machiavelli and Kautilya never faced. Plus, their respective Princes were able," says a senior Congress leader about the meltdown set off by Digvijaya Singh, 78, the former Chief Minister of Madhya Pradesh. Singh, a master politician, recently threw a gauntlet at Rahul Gandhi through a social media post, in which he praised the organisational strength of the RSS and even tagged everyone from Rahul, Priyanka Gandhi, Mallikarjun Kharge and Jairam Ramesh to Prime Minister Narendra Modi. Singh then attended the last Congress Working Committee meeting and made the same point in person. There, he was heard in utter silence, with his intervention espousing no comments from the audience. 

I spoke to a cross-section of Congress leaders before writing this column - both the rebels who want change in the party and the coterie to Rahul Gandhi who want status quo. The biggest takeaway is that Rahul cannot avoid a change if he continues to be unavailable and elusive.
